KS DARTOM BOGORIA awaits “refreshed” Fakel-GAZPROM Orenburg

In TT European Champions Legue Men Group D five times winners Russia’s Fakel-Gazprom Orenburg traveling to Poland where the host is KS DARTOM BOGORIA Grodzisk Mazowiecki. In Poland will also play Germany’s TTC Neu-Ulm and SF SKK El Nino Praha from Czech Republic.

Table tennis heavyweights Fakel GAZPROM led by Dimitrij OVTCHAROV who recently had a surgery have some novelties in their lineup. Also Vladimir SAMSONOV recently decided to put an end to playing career.

“This season the lineup of Fakel-Gazprom has changed significantly. In addition to Dimitrij OVTCHAROV Vladimir SAMSONOV and Marcos FREITAS our team has three new players: LIN Yun-Ju Hugo CALDERANO and Aleksandr SHIBAEV. All our players are in good physical shape and ready for the TTCL upcoming matches. This fact is confirmed by the confident victories of our team in all five matches of the Russian Championship R1 which was held in Orenburg in the middle of October ” stated Coach Vladimir ENDLOV.

The hosts has also strong aces in their sleave. At the top of the list is Panagiotis GIONIS followed by Marek BADOWSKI Pawel SIRUCEK Milosz REDZIMSKI CHUANG Chih-Yuan Michal GAWLAS Patryk PYSK SUN Shiyu. Coach ENDLOV called for caution.

“The main opponent in our group is a Polish club KS Dartom Bogoria Grodzisk Mazowiecki. It is a strong European club with high-level players. We expect many interesting and intense matches in this season. We believe that all our players will be able to show a confident powerful and spectacular table tennis ” added Vladimir ENDOLOV.

For SF SKK El Nino Praha are listed: Jiri VRABLIK Jakub ZELINKA Frantisek ONDERKA Petr KAUCKY Jakub KAUCKY Martin SIP Matej STACH Krystof PRIDA whilst for TTC Neu Ulm plays Ionnis SGOUROPOULOS Lev KATSMAN Tiago APOLONIA Vladimir SIDORENKO Kay STUMPER Rudolf STUMPER.

The European Table Tennis Union (ETTU) is the governing body of the sport of table tennis in Europe, and is the only authority recognized for this purpose by the International Table Tennis Federation. The ETTU deals with all matters relating to table tennis at a European level, including the development and promotion of the sport in the territories controlled by its 58 member associations, and the organization of continental table tennis competitions, including the European Championships.
